  I have at last pushed myself to get back in the workshop, its been months since I turned. This piece stands 4" high and 3" at widest made from Horse Chestnut that had a horrible grey splated wash through the wood, tuned and hand carved then some texturing applied before coloring with airbrushed acrylics. This is inspired from a piece I saw last year, I dont know where on a forum or in the flesh but when I saw the piece I made a mental note that I would try it out one day so here it is.
